public class ConsistencyCheckServiceIntegrationTest
{
private final GraphStoreFixture fixture = new GraphStoreFixture( getRecordFormatName() )
{
@Override
protected void generateInitialData( GraphDatabaseService graphDb )
{
try ( org.neo4j.graphdb.Transaction tx = graphDb.beginTx() )
{
Node node1 = set( graphDb.createNode() );
Node node2 = set( graphDb.createNode(), property( "key", "exampleValue" ) );
node1.createRelationshipTo( node2, RelationshipType.withName( "C" ) );
tx.success();
}
}
};
private final TestDirectory testDirectory = TestDirectory.testDirectory();
@Rule
public final RuleChain chain = RuleChain.outerRule( testDirectory ).around( fixture );
@Test
public void reportNotUsedRelationshipReferencedInChain() throws Exception
{
prepareDbWithDeletedRelationshipPartOfTheChain();
Date timestamp = new Date();
ConsistencyCheckService service = new ConsistencyCheckService( timestamp );
Config configuration = Config.defaults( settings() );
ConsistencyCheckService.Result result = runFullConsistencyCheck( service, configuration );
assertFalse( result.isSuccessful() );
File reportFile = result.reportFile();
assertTrue( "Consistency check report file should be generated.", reportFile.exists() );
assertThat( "Expected to see report about not deleted relationship record present as part of a chain",
Files.readAllLines( reportFile.toPath() ).toString(),
containsString( "The relationship record is not in use, but referenced from relationships chain.") );
}
@Test
public void shouldSucceedIfStoreIsConsistent() throws Exception
{
// given
Date timestamp = new Date();
ConsistencyCheckService service = new ConsistencyCheckService( timestamp );
Config configuration = Config.defaults( settings() );
// when
ConsistencyCheckService.Result result = runFullConsistencyCheck( service, configuration );
// then
assertTrue( result.isSuccessful() );
File reportFile = result.reportFile();
assertFalse( "Unexpected generation of consistency check report file: " + reportFile, reportFile.exists() );
}
@Test
public void shouldFailIfTheStoreInNotConsistent() throws Exception
{
// given
breakNodeStore();
Date timestamp = new Date();
ConsistencyCheckService service = new ConsistencyCheckService( timestamp );
String logsDir = testDirectory.directory().getPath();
Config configuration = Config.defaults(
settings( GraphDatabaseSettings.logs_directory.name(), logsDir ) );
// when
ConsistencyCheckService.Result result = runFullConsistencyCheck( service, configuration );
// then
assertFalse( result.isSuccessful() );
String reportFile = format( "inconsistencies-%s.report",
new SimpleDateFormat( "yyyy-MM-dd.HH.mm.ss" ).format( timestamp ) );
assertEquals( new File( logsDir, reportFile ), result.reportFile() );
assertTrue( "Inconsistency report file not generated", result.reportFile().exists() );
}
@Test
public void shouldNotReportDuplicateForHugeLongValues() throws Exception
{
// given
ConsistencyCheckService service = new ConsistencyCheckService();
Config configuration = Config.defaults( settings() );
GraphDatabaseService db = new TestGraphDatabaseFactory().newEmbeddedDatabaseBuilder( testDirectory.graphDbDir() )
.setConfig( GraphDatabaseSettings.record_format, getRecordFormatName() )
.setConfig( "dbms.backup.enabled", "false" )
.newGraphDatabase();
String propertyKey = "itemId";
Label label = Label.label( "Item" );
try ( Transaction tx = db.beginTx() )
{
db.schema().constraintFor( label ).assertPropertyIsUnique( propertyKey ).create();
tx.success();
}
try ( Transaction tx = db.beginTx() )
{
set( db.createNode( label ), property( propertyKey, 973305894188596880L ) );
set( db.createNode( label ), property( propertyKey, 973305894188596864L ) );
tx.success();
}
db.shutdown();
// when
Result result = runFullConsistencyCheck( service, configuration );
// then
assertTrue( result.isSuccessful() );
}
@Test
public void shouldAllowGraphCheckDisabled() throws ConsistencyCheckIncompleteException
{
GraphDatabaseService gds = getGraphDatabaseService();
try ( Transaction tx = gds.beginTx() )
{
gds.createNode();
tx.success();
}
gds.shutdown();
ConsistencyCheckService service = new ConsistencyCheckService();
Config configuration = Config.defaults(
settings( ConsistencyCheckSettings.consistency_check_graph.name(), Settings.FALSE ) );
// when
Result result = runFullConsistencyCheck( service, configuration );
// then
assertTrue( result.isSuccessful() );
}
@Test
public void shouldReportMissingSchemaIndex() throws Exception
{
// given
File storeDir = testDirectory.absolutePath();
GraphDatabaseService gds = getGraphDatabaseService( storeDir );
Label label = Label.label( "label" );
String propKey = "propKey";
createIndex( gds, label, propKey );
gds.shutdown();
// when
File schemaDir = findFile( "schema", storeDir );
FileUtils.deleteRecursively( schemaDir );
ConsistencyCheckService service = new ConsistencyCheckService();
Config configuration = Config.defaults( settings() );
Result result = runFullConsistencyCheck( service, configuration, storeDir );
// then
assertTrue( result.isSuccessful() );
File reportFile = result.reportFile();
assertTrue( "Consistency check report file should be generated.", reportFile.exists() );
assertThat( "Expected to see report about schema index not being online",
Files.readAllLines( reportFile.toPath() ).toString(), allOf(
containsString( "schema rule" ),
containsString( "not online" )
) );
}
@Test
public void oldLuceneSchemaIndexShouldBeConsideredConsistentWithFusionProvider() throws Exception
{
File storeDir = testDirectory.graphDbDir();
String enableNativeIndex = GraphDatabaseSettings.enable_native_schema_index.name();
Label label = Label.label( "label" );
String propKey = "propKey";
// Given a lucene index
GraphDatabaseService db = getGraphDatabaseService( storeDir, enableNativeIndex, Settings.FALSE );
createIndex( db, label, propKey );
try ( Transaction tx = db.beginTx() )
{
db.createNode( label ).setProperty( propKey, 1 );
db.createNode( label ).setProperty( propKey, "string" );
tx.success();
}
db.shutdown();
ConsistencyCheckService service = new ConsistencyCheckService();
Config configuration =
Config.defaults( settings( enableNativeIndex, Settings.TRUE ) );
Result result = runFullConsistencyCheck( service, configuration, storeDir );
assertTrue( result.isSuccessful() );
}
private void createIndex( GraphDatabaseService gds, Label label, String propKey )
{
IndexDefinition indexDefinition;
try ( Transaction tx = gds.beginTx() )
{
indexDefinition = gds.schema().indexFor( label ).on( propKey ).create();
tx.success();
}
try ( Transaction tx = gds.beginTx() )
{
gds.schema().awaitIndexOnline( indexDefinition, 1, TimeUnit.MINUTES );
tx.success();
}
}
private File findFile( String targetFile, File directory )
{
File file = new File( directory, targetFile );
if ( !file.exists() )
{
fail( "Could not find file " + targetFile );
}
return file;
}
private GraphDatabaseService getGraphDatabaseService()
{
return getGraphDatabaseService( testDirectory.absolutePath() );
}
private GraphDatabaseService getGraphDatabaseService( File storeDir )
{
return getGraphDatabaseService( storeDir, new String[0] );
}
private GraphDatabaseService getGraphDatabaseService( File storeDir, String... settings )
{
GraphDatabaseBuilder builder = new TestGraphDatabaseFactory().newEmbeddedDatabaseBuilder( storeDir );
builder.setConfig( settings( settings ) );
return builder.newGraphDatabase();
}
private void prepareDbWithDeletedRelationshipPartOfTheChain()
{
GraphDatabaseAPI db = (GraphDatabaseAPI) new TestGraphDatabaseFactory().newEmbeddedDatabaseBuilder( testDirectory.graphDbDir() )
.setConfig( GraphDatabaseSettings.record_format, getRecordFormatName() )
.setConfig( "dbms.backup.enabled", "false" )
.newGraphDatabase();
try
{
RelationshipType relationshipType = RelationshipType.withName( "testRelationshipType" );
try ( Transaction tx = db.beginTx() )
{
Node node1 = set( db.createNode() );
Node node2 = set( db.createNode(), property( "key", "value" ) );
node1.createRelationshipTo( node2, relationshipType );
node1.createRelationshipTo( node2, relationshipType );
node1.createRelationshipTo( node2, relationshipType );
node1.createRelationshipTo( node2, relationshipType );
node1.createRelationshipTo( node2, relationshipType );
node1.createRelationshipTo( node2, relationshipType );
tx.success();
}
RecordStorageEngine recordStorageEngine = db.getDependencyResolver().resolveDependency( RecordStorageEngine.class );
NeoStores neoStores = recordStorageEngine.testAccessNeoStores();
RelationshipStore relationshipStore = neoStores.getRelationshipStore();
RelationshipRecord relationshipRecord = new RelationshipRecord( -1 );
RelationshipRecord record = relationshipStore.getRecord( 4, relationshipRecord, RecordLoad.FORCE );
record.setInUse( false );
relationshipStore.updateRecord( relationshipRecord );
}
finally
{
db.shutdown();
}
}
protected Map<String,String> settings( String... strings )
{
Map<String, String> defaults = new HashMap<>();
defaults.put( GraphDatabaseSettings.pagecache_memory.name(), "8m" );
defaults.put( GraphDatabaseSettings.record_format.name(), getRecordFormatName() );
defaults.put( "dbms.backup.enabled", "false" );
return stringMap( defaults, strings );
}
private void breakNodeStore() throws TransactionFailureException
{
fixture.apply( new GraphStoreFixture.Transaction()
{
@Override
protected void transactionData( GraphStoreFixture.TransactionDataBuilder tx,
GraphStoreFixture.IdGenerator next )
{
tx.create( new NodeRecord( next.node(), false, next.relationship(), -1 ) );
}
} );
}
private Result runFullConsistencyCheck( ConsistencyCheckService service, Config configuration )
throws ConsistencyCheckIncompleteException
{
return runFullConsistencyCheck( service, configuration, fixture.directory() );
}
private Result runFullConsistencyCheck( ConsistencyCheckService service, Config configuration, File storeDir )
throws ConsistencyCheckIncompleteException
{
return service.runFullConsistencyCheck( storeDir,
configuration, ProgressMonitorFactory.NONE, NullLogProvider.getInstance(), false );
}
protected String getRecordFormatName()
{
return StringUtils.EMPTY;
}
}
